We were in the world between 8/12-8/28 (with a week in vero somewhere in the middle).

I saw MSEP 3 times during that time. That was enough for me. I want spectro back.

While my wife and I both had severe nostalgia going while we watched the parade, nostalgia can never be used as an engine to maintain entertainment....because it wears off fast.

By the third time, I was noticing things about MSEP that I thought were cheap and nasty. For example, on several floats there were lights arranged in the shape of a hidden mickey/mouse ears. But the arrangements of those mouse ears were in such disrepair that the circles forming the mouse ears were no longer perfect circles. things were bent, not straight. lights were out....

It looked 'six flags' to me.


I never got that feeling when I watched spectromagic, and I've seen that parade dozens of times.



If TDO is going to hari-kari by sending spectro to eurodisney, they'd better do some serious repair work to MSEP first.
